If you signed up for a Neuralink brain implant, you'll have your skull cut by a brain surgeon before he uses a robot to insert 64 of these tiny threads called electrodes into your brain tissue, which can sense extremely small electrical pulses from your brain cells or stimulate your brain cells so you can see or do or think something.
